MHT CET Syllabus Change

The Maharashtra State CET Cell has released the MHT CET 2026 syllabus online. The syllabus for Maharashtra CET includes topics from classes 11th and 12th. Candidates must check the MHT CET syllabus 2026 to know what topics have been added and/or removed this year. Preparing as per the official syllabus is important to cover all that lies in the scope of the MHT CET exam.

80 percent weightage is given to class 12th topics, while the remaining 20 percent is from class 11th topics. The questions will be based on the Syllabus of the State Council of Educational Research and Training, Maharashtra.

What’s New in MHT CET 2026?

A major update in the MHT CET 2026 exam is the frequency of its conduct. This year onwards, the MHT CET exam will be held twice a year for engineering and MBA. This move will give students another opportunity to improve their results. The MHT CET 2026 exam date for session 1 was April 11 to 19 (PCM) and April 21 to 26 (PCB). The MHT CET second session exam was conducted from May 10 to 11 (PCB) and May 12 to 21 (PCM).

Q:   Is MHT CET syllabus same for PCM and PCB groups?
A: 

The syllabus for MHT CET PCM (BE/BTech) and PCB (BPharma) is different. MHT CET PCM exam is conducted for admission to BE/BTech while the PCB examis conducted for BPharma courses.  MHT CET PCM syllabus consists of Physics, Chemistry and Mathematics. PCB syllabus has Biology, Physics and Chemistry. Candidates must note that Physics and Chemistry syllabus is common/same in both PCB and PCM papers. Topics Added in MHT CET 2026 Syllabus Subject-wise

Compared to last year, no new topics have been added to the syllabus. In 2025, the authorities added topics in Physics, Chemistry and Maths.

Candidates can check the list of topics added last year below.

  • Physics - Vectors and Error Analysis
  • Chemistry - Chemistry in everyday life
  • Mathematics - Conic section

Deleted Topics in MHT CET 2026 Syllabus

There is no removal of topics from the MHT CET 2026 syllabus. Last year, the authorities removed mathematics topics from the syllabus.

  • Physics - No topics removed
  • Chemistry - No topics removed
  • Mathematics - Measures of dispersion

MHT CET 2026 Topic-wise Syllabus

Candidates can check below for the updated MHT CET syllabus 2026 for each subject. The tables below contain both classes 11th and 12th topics.

Class 11th syllabus

Class 12th syllabus

Physics

Vectors, Error Analysis, Motion in a plane, Laws of Motion, Gravitation, Thermal properties of matter, Sound, Optics, Electrostatics, Semiconductors

Circular motion, Rotational motion, Oscillations, Gravitation, Elasticity, Electrostatics, Wave Motion, Magnetism, Surface Tension, Wave Theory of Light, Stationary Waves, Kinetic Theory of Gases and Radiation, Interference and Diffraction, Current Electricity, Magnetic Effects of Electric Current, Electromagnetic Inductions, Electrons and Photons, Atoms, Molecules, and Nuclei, Semiconductors, Communication Systems

Chemistry

Some Basic concepts of chemistry, Structure of atom, Chemical Bonding, Redox reactions, Elements of group 1 and 2, States of Matter (Gaseous and Liquids), Adsorption and colloids (Surface Chemistry), Hydrocarbons, Basic principles of organic chemistry, Chemistry in everyday life.

Solid State, Chemical Thermodynamics and Energetic, Electrochemistry, General Principles and Processes of Isolation, Solutions and Colligative Properties, p-Block elements, Group 15 elements, d and f Block Elements, Chemical Kinetics, Coordination Compounds, Halogen, Derivatives of Alkanes (and arenes), Aldehydes, Ketones and Carboxylic Acids, Organic Compounds Containing Nitrogen, Alcohols, Phenols and Ether Alcohol, Polymers, Chemistry in Everyday Life, Biomolecules, Carbohydrates

Mathematics

Trigonometry II, Straight Line, Circle, Probability, Complex Numbers, Permutations and Combinations, Functions, Limits, Continuity, Conic Section

Mathematical Logic Statements, Matrices, Pair of Straight Lines, Circle, Line, Conics, Trigonometric Functions, Vectors, Three Dimensional Geometry, Plane, Linear Programming Problems, Continuity, Applications of Derivatives, Integration, Differentiation, Applications of Definite Integral, Differential Equation, Probability Distribution, Statistics, Bernoulli Trials and Binomial Distribution

Biology

Biomolecules, Respiration and Energy Transfer, Human Nutrition, Excretion and Osmoregulation

Genetic Basis of Inheritance, Gene its nature, expression, and regulation, Biotechnology Process and Application, Enhancement in Food Production, Microbes in Human Welfare, Photosynthesis, Respiration, Reproduction in Plants, Organisms and Environment

MHT CET 2026 Exam Pattern

Maharashtra State Common Entrance Test (CET) Cell has also announced the MHT CET 2026 exam pattern. Candidates can check the MHT CET exam pattern below. The exam pattern reveals details on the exam mode, duration, marking scheme, types of questions and subject-wise distribution.

Particulars

Details

Mode of Examination

Online, Computer-Based Test

Number of Sections

For PCM Group

Section 1- Physics and Chemistry

Section 2- Mathematics

For PCB Group

Section 1- Physics and Chemistry

Section 2- Biology

Duration of Exam

180 minutes (90 minutes for each section)

Type of Questions

Multiple Choice Questions

Total number of Questions

PCM Group - 150 Questions (50 from each subject)

PCB Group - 200 Questions (100 from Biology and 50 each from Physics & Chemistry)

Total Marks

200 marks (100 marks for each section)

Language of Examination

  • Mathematics will be in the English language

  • Physics and Chemistry will be in English/Urdu/Marathi

  • Biology will be in English/Urdu/Marathi

Marking Scheme

Physics & Chemistry - 1 mark will be awarded for every correct answer.

Mathematics - 2 marks will be awarded for every correct answer.

Biology - 1 mark will be awarded for every correct answer.

Negative Marking

No negative marking
